Coaster Company Great Products..Horrible Customer Service

Coaster Furniture Company has no customer service.

I deal with many vendors a day. Some stand out more than others. Aside from having the best selling items or pricing it is the Customer Service of the vendors that stands out the most. I have been doing business on and off with Coaster Company for at least 10 years, either directly or through my clients.

It has always surprised my how Coaster Company has managed to remain in business for over 20 years with the horrible Customer Service.

Coaster Company carries a vast inventory of home furnishings and décor. The large variety and quality of their items have helped keep them as a desirable account for any small home furnishings store.

This is where all falls apart.

Sales Representatives fail to deliver vital information such as Discontinued Items, Promotions, New Catalogs and most importantly Price Changes. Coaster finally now offers you the ability to check stock online. If only it was accurate……

When it comes to manufacturer defects, good luck. They offer a One Year Warranty but no Customer Service at all to the Consumer. This is most frustrating for consumers when they find themselves purchasing from companies that may no longer be operating. Coaster asks that consumers deal directly with the Retail Store. Therefore, if you are a consumer you will only find yourself getting frustrated.

For retailers; manufacturer defects can certainly impact your business a great deal. Some defects cannot be detected upon inspection of the item; certain defects appear once the item has been assembled. Most frustrating to you and the consumer.

Regular Customer Service agents at the call center offer you no courtesy, most are RUDE and have no knowledge of the items offered. I have written and complained to the management there and received no response. To complain about them is useless. As the CSR’s work together they cover up for each other and I have known them to intercept correspondence to the heads of the departments.

Why can’t they train their Customer Service Agents?

I am know working with two other leading companies of quality home furnishings and décor to allow me to diminish the sales I can generate for Coaster.

My biggest headache with Coaster has been that CSR will take items from my Confirmed Order and sell them to another retailer. This can ultimately can result in a full refund and unhappy customer. Some of the Sales Reps are paid commission or simply just want to favor a single customer. Coaster is HORRIBLE to provide you with any SUPPORT.

I would like to see Coaster train and educate all the representatives, to inspect all merchandise and offer the retailers outstanding support. To keep in mind the Customer Service Representatives are the make-up of their company and without the (retailers and) online retailers; Coaster could no longer be.

If you are interested in opening an account with Coaster you can visit their site at Coaster Company. They do require that you have a retail location and a minimum order of $2,500-$5,000.00. This varies on the location. Again, Coaster offers wonderful items that you can make money on, but be wary about the lack of customer service, discontinued items, price changes and inventory.

My ratings for Coaster are:

Product: 4 out 5

Customer Service: 1 out of 5

Finding & Understanding How Drop Ship Works

Drop shipping is the shipping of merchandise from a supplier directly to a retailer’s customer. This means that the retailer can ship to their customers directly from the suppliers’ warehouses. You (the retailer) will not have to worry about stocking the inventory. This process minimizes risk because the retailer does not need to buy the product until it has sold. Therefore, you will not need to invest any capital for inventory.

Suppliers take care of the warehousing, packaging, and shipping of products, saving you a great deal of money and time. The flexibility of using a Drop Shipper is that you save money on overhead cost. The Drop Shipper will provide you with a stock image and the description of the item.

This is a good way to start selling online brand new product from a reputable supplier carrying Name Brand names. You can sell the product at auction sites, fixed price marketplaces or your own website.


How it works:

1. Find products to sell from your Drop Shippers online catalog

2. List those products on a web site or auction (use the descriptions and images on our site).

3. Once an item is sold and paid for; place your order with the Drop Shipper

4. Input your Buyers Shipping information, pay the Drop Shipper the cost for the item and shipping.

5. Upon receipt of your payment, the Drop Shipper with then turn-around and ship directly to the customer.

6. You can provide your customer with the Tracking Number, Monitor the delivery arrives in a timely manner

Here is their story:

Our Founding Story

“Two strangers were on parallel paths, working to connect marginalized artisans in developing countries with shoppers in America. This is the story of how their paths crossed to create WorldofGood.com.

Not long ago, in a country far, far away….
It’s the Summer of 2003, Robert Chatwani and Priya Haji, two San Francisco Bay Area-based thirty-somethings, perfect strangers at the time, and future proud founders of WorldofGood.com, are walking similar paths at two different open-air markets—just miles away from one another in Western India.

Each is striking up conversations with the local artisans, and each is hearing the same story over and over: We need more shoppers like you; greater access to markets. We would be able to create so much more opportunity for ourselves, our families, our communities, if we just had more people buying.

And the entrepreneurial wheels in both of their heads began to turn.

They both knew there had to be a way to link these talented artisans—and thousands more like them—with the millions of shoppers back home that buy $55 billion worth of mass-produced, factory- and sweatshop-made stuff every year. Didn’t there?

Aaaaand…action!
Back home, our two wily do-gooders began to craft their plans of attack.

Robert, a young rising executive at eBay, took his idea straight to the top of the food chain, securing the support of founder Pierre Omidyar, then-CEO Meg Whitman, and other key players in the company’s innovative, forward-thinking leadership team.

Priya, a seasoned entrepreneur with two social enterprises under her belt, convinced a couple of her newly minted MBA buddies to quit their jobs to start their own company, a fair trade wholesale business they called World of Good, Inc.

It wasn’t until two years later that Robert and Priya would realize they needed each other to complete the task at hand.

Full circle
Fast forward to Fall 2005. An introduction from a mutual friend, one serendipitous (and very, very long) phone call later, and the idea for the WorldofGood.com marketplace was born.

It was a no-brainer, and a perfect match.

Robert had, in eBay, a platform where $60 billion worth of stuff is sold every year—more and more of which was being spent on “good” products by an increasingly engaged buyer base. Distribution and global marketing reach? Check!

Priya had, in two years at the helm of World of Good, Inc., built the relationships and knowledge to authentically understand and navigate the inner workings of the global fair trade market. Supply chain know-how and industry credibility? Check!

It was only a matter of time before they had recruited a mighty team of do-gooders, and rallied hundreds of like-minded organizations together—all for the first time—around one simple, but pretty groundbreaking idea: one online destination where people could go to shop for products that make a positive impact on the world.

Now, five years later, those same artisans from those same open air markets in Western India—as well as thousands like them from all over the world—can sell their wares to millions of shoppers browsing the WorldofGood.com website.

One idea, two crafty minds, and a windfall of support from kindred spirits all over the world—and we are well on our way to figuring out how to reach the Big Lofty Goal: a steady job, healthy happy families, and a positive, promising future for millions.”

Here is what ShopGoodWill has to say:

shopgoodwill.com is the first Internet auction site created, owned and operated by a nonprofit organization. It was created and is operated by Goodwill of Orange County (Santa Ana, CA). Participating Goodwill’s from across the country offer for auction on the site a wide array of art, antiques and collectibles as well as new and nearly new items pulled from their vast inventories of donated goods. From unique one-of-a-kind items to estate pieces, the depth of resources is enormous. Revenues from these auction sales fund Goodwill’s education, training and job placement programs for people with disabilities and other barriers.

Goodwill‘s global presence extends to five continents, with 171 full member organizations in four countries. In addition, there are 15 affiliate members in 13 countries. Through its services, Goodwill’s network helps people overcome barriers to employment and become independent, tax-paying members of their communities. In 2005, Goodwill Industries International collectively served over 846,000 individuals.
